Germany has reportedly agreed to fund the provision of 50,000 strike drones to Ukraine, according to a source cited by Reuters. The move marks a significant escalation in military support as Ukraine continues to defend itself amid ongoing conflict. Details about the drone models, deployment timeline, and the scope of Germany’s involvement remain closely guarded, but the development underscores Berlin’s intensified commitment to bolstering Ukraine’s defense capabilities.
